With back-to-school the order of the day, Veritas College Preparatory welcomed this year’s Grade Ones earlier this morning (January 17).
On this auspicious day, the girls looked beautiful, and the boys were dapper in their new uniforms.

Grade One teachers Daniela Taylor and Chelsey Howard had a message: “Today is the first day of your ‘big school’ adventure.
“We hope to instil a love for learning and for you to make the most of every experience. We are excited to have you in our classes and can’t wait to watch you blossom,” the duo expressed.
